Understanding CrossFit Retreats in the UK

CrossFit retreats have become increasingly popular across the United Kingdom, offering participants a chance to step away from their regular box routines and immerse themselves in intensive training environments. These weekend breaks typically combine multiple daily workouts with recovery sessions, nutritional guidance, and social activities. The CrossFit retreats UK weekend breaks field memo highlights that most retreats accommodate athletes of all levels, from beginners exploring the sport to competitive athletes seeking performance enhancement.

The typical retreat format includes morning and evening training sessions, with afternoons reserved for recovery, workshops, or exploration of the surrounding area. Many facilities provide accommodation, meals, and access to specialized equipment not always available at standard CrossFit boxes. The community aspect remains central to the retreat experience, fostering connections among participants who share similar fitness goals and lifestyle values.

What to Expect During Your Retreat

A typical CrossFit retreat weekend begins with arrival and registration, followed by an orientation session explaining the schedule and facility layout. Most retreats feature two training sessions daily, with morning workouts focusing on strength development and evening sessions emphasizing metabolic conditioning. Between sessions, participants enjoy meals designed to support athletic performance, often prepared by nutritionists familiar with CrossFit dietary requirements.

Accommodation varies from luxury hotel rooms to shared dormitory-style lodging, depending on your budget and preferences. Many retreats include workshops covering topics such as mobility, nutrition, injury prevention, and competition preparation. Evening activities might include social gatherings, film screenings, or guided meditation sessions. Choosing the Right Retreat for Your Goals

Selecting an appropriate CrossFit retreat requires honest assessment of your fitness level, training goals, and personal preferences. Beginners should seek retreats explicitly welcoming newcomers, with scaled workouts and foundational coaching. Intermediate athletes might prioritize retreats offering specialized programming in their areas of interest, whether gymnastics, weightlifting, or endurance. Advanced competitors often seek retreats led by elite coaches or featuring competition-style programming.

Budget considerations significantly influence retreat selection. Weekend breaks range from budget-friendly options around £300-500 to luxury experiences exceeding £1500, depending on accommodation quality, meal provision, and coaching expertise. Timing matters considerably when planning your retreat. Summer months offer pleasant weather and outdoor training opportunities, while winter retreats provide quieter experiences and potentially lower costs. Consider your competition schedule, work commitments, and recovery needs when selecting your dates. Reading reviews from previous participants provides invaluable insights into coaching quality, facility standards, and overall experience authenticity.

Preparing for Your CrossFit Retreat

Proper preparation ensures you maximize your retreat investment and minimize injury risk. Begin training consistently at least four weeks before your retreat, establishing baseline fitness and allowing your body to adapt to increased volume. Communicate any injuries, limitations, or health concerns to retreat organizers in advance, enabling coaches to provide appropriate modifications.

Pack strategically, bringing comfortable training clothes, quality footwear, and any personal recovery tools you regularly use. Most retreats provide basic amenities, but familiar items enhance comfort. Arrive well-rested and hydrated, avoiding heavy travel immediately before training begins. Mental preparation proves equally important—approach the retreat with realistic expectations and openness to learning from experienced coaches and fellow participants.

Post-Retreat Recovery and Progression

The retreat experience extends beyond the weekend itself. Most participants experience significant fatigue in the days following intensive training, requiring adequate sleep, nutrition, and active recovery. Implement the programming and coaching insights gained during your retreat into your regular training routine. Many successful athletes schedule retreats strategically within their annual training plan, using them as peak training blocks followed by planned deload periods.

Document your retreat experience through notes, photos, or video recordings of key coaching moments. This documentation helps reinforce learning and provides motivation during challenging training phases. Connect with fellow retreat participants through social media or local CrossFit communities, maintaining the relationships and accountability established during your weekend break.
